What happens when two people long to be together . . . but are worlds apart? The Craving is an award-winning, split time Christian romance for young adults.A stadium collapse. A coma. A breathtaking journey of discovery.Story remained in my mind long after reading. A great and original story.The writing is very engaging and has the elements necessary to get under the reader's skin.Commendable. Very intriguing.-CALEB Award judges' comments. 2020Will Sutherland saves a girl from a falling beam in a stadium collapse, and is plunged into a coma. Finding himself on the Island of Eldrad, Will longs to go home to Aporto Bay. He battles addiction and anger against his rival, Ben Maddock, and his own father who had left the family.Meanwhile, Erin, the girl Will saved in the tragic accident, visits him in hospital, desperate for him to wake up. Will takes an extraordinary journey to find the truth of his life. He's aided by the intriguing cave dwellers and a King.Will visits Idella city where desires are fulfilled, and he's given the keys to the astonishing worlds behind the seven doors of The House of Wisdom.Why does Will change his mind about staying on the island? What happens when he wakes from the coma a completely different person?This book has themes of hardship, transformation and the search for happiness. It is rich with twists and turns in an explosive mix of contemporary and fantasy worlds.
